本文实例为大家分享了C++实现彩色飞机大战的具体代码,供大家参考,具体内容如下

1.基本的能够实现键盘按上下左右进行控制飞机,击杀敌人飞机,记录得分,(缺点:死亡后不能从新玩,需要重新启动程序,),缺点将在2中解决

/*隐藏光标的代码
#include <stdio.h>
#include <windows.h>
int main()
{
HANDLE handle = GetStdHandle(STD_OUTPUT_HANDLE);
CONSOLE_CURSOR_INFO CursorInfo;
GetConsoleCursorInfo(handle, &CursorInfo);//获取控制台光标信息
CursorInfo.bVisible = false; //隐藏控制台光标
SetConsoleCursorInfo(handle, &CursorInfo);//设置控制台光标状态
 
 
getchar();
}*/
/* 
 明白两个事实,
 敌人飞机和自己的飞机的横坐标和纵坐标相同时 表示死亡
 敌人飞机和自己的子弹碰撞即 子弹坐标和自己子弹的坐标相同时,飞机死亡并且加分,
*/

#include "stdio.h"
#include <windows.h>
#include <conio.h>
#include <time.h>
#define Esc 27 //退出
#define Up 72 //上,下,左,右
#define Down 80
#define Left 75
#define Right 77
#define Kong 32 //发射子弹


int x = 10; //飞机坐标
int y = 18;

int d2 = 10;//敌机坐标
int d1 = 10;
int d = 10;//d 和r 用来进行碰撞检测
int r = 1;
int r1 = 1;
int r2 = 1;


int t = 1; // 游戏结束
int f = 0; // 计分数
int m = 5; // 敌机数
int j = 0; // 歼敌数
char p; // 接受按键


void kongzhi(int bx, int by);//声明函数
void huatu();


void gotoxy(int x, int y) //移动坐标
{
 COORD coord;
 coord.X = x;
 coord.Y = y;
 SetConsoleCursorPosition(GetStdHandle(STD_OUTPUT_HANDLE), coord);
 SetConsoleTextAttribute(GetStdHandle(STD_OUTPUT_HANDLE),3);
 
}
void gotoxy_red(int x, int y) //移动坐标
{
 COORD coord;
 coord.X = x;
 coord.Y = y;
 SetConsoleCursorPosition(GetStdHandle(STD_OUTPUT_HANDLE), coord);
 SetConsoleTextAttribute(GetStdHandle(STD_OUTPUT_HANDLE),4);
 
}
void gotoxy_blue(int x, int y) //移动坐标
{
 COORD coord;
 coord.X = x;
 coord.Y = y;
 SetConsoleCursorPosition(GetStdHandle(STD_OUTPUT_HANDLE), coord);
 SetConsoleTextAttribute(GetStdHandle(STD_OUTPUT_HANDLE),1);
 
}
void gotoxy_green(int x, int y) //移动坐标
{
 COORD coord;
 coord.X = x;
 coord.Y = y;
 SetConsoleCursorPosition(GetStdHandle(STD_OUTPUT_HANDLE), coord);
 SetConsoleTextAttribute(GetStdHandle(STD_OUTPUT_HANDLE),2);
 
}
void hidden()//隐藏光标,不让光标显示
{
 HANDLE hOut = GetStdHandle(STD_OUTPUT_HANDLE);
 CONSOLE_CURSOR_INFO cci;
 GetConsoleCursorInfo(hOut, &cci);
 cci.bVisible = 0;//赋1为显示,赋0为隐藏
 SetConsoleCursorInfo(hOut, &cci);
}
//**************************************************************************************


//说明
void shuoming()
{
 printf("\t\t\t\n\n\n\n");
 gotoxy_blue(0, 0);
 printf("\t\t\t\t\t\t\tPlane Control\n\n"
 "\t\t\t\t\t\t\t\tUP\n\n"
 "\t\t\t\t\t\t\tDown\n\n"
 "\t\t\t\t\t\t\tLeft \n\n"
 "\t\t\t\t\t\t\tRight \n\n"
 "\t\t\t\t\t\t\t bullet space\n\n\n"
 "\t\t\t\t\t\t\tQuit Esc\n");
 

 gotoxy_red(0, 0);
}


//****************************************************************************************


//判断我机死没死/游戏结束
void byebye()
{
 if (((x == d && y == r) || (x == d1 && y == r1) || (x == d2 && y == r2))||( (d>=19||r>=19)||(d1>=19||r1>=19)||(d1>=19||r1>=19) ))
 {
 gotoxy(1, 3);
 printf(" !!! 游戏结束 !!!\n"
 "*******************\n"
 " 您的总得分: %d\n\n"
 " 敌机数: %d\n"
 " 歼敌数: %d\n"
 " 命中率: %.0f %%\n"
 "*******************\n", f, m, j, ((float)j / (float)m) * 100);
 while (!_kbhit())
 {
 Sleep(500);
 gotoxy(1, 12);
 printf(" 继续请按任意键...\n\n\n");
 Sleep(900);
 gotoxy(1, 12);
 printf(" ");
 }
 gotoxy_red(0, 0);
 huatu();
 f = 0; m = 0; j = 0;
 if (x >= 18) x--;
 else x++;
 gotoxy(x, y);
 printf("A");
 }
}
// 计分/更新敌机
void jifan()
{ //x,y是子弹的坐标
 if (x == d && y == r) // d=10, r=1, d,d1,d2 是敌机的x轴, 为10 ,r为敌机的纵坐标
 {
 gotoxy(d, r); printf("3");
 Sleep(200);
 gotoxy(d, r); printf(" "); f += 2; r = 0; j++;//让r=0,即是让敌人的飞机消失
 }
 if (x == d1 && y == r1)
 {
 gotoxy(d1, r1); printf("1");
 Sleep(200);
 gotoxy(d1, r1); printf(" "); f += 3; r1 = 0; j++;
 }
 if (x == d2 && y == r2)
 {
 gotoxy(d2, r2); printf("0");
 Sleep(200);
 gotoxy(d2, r2); printf(" "); f += 1; r2 = 0; j++;
 }

 gotoxy(57, 2);
 printf("%d\n", f);

}
//画图
void huatu()
{
 int i, n;

 for (i = 0; i <= 20; i++)
 {
 for (n = 0; n <= 20; n++)
 {
 printf("*");
 }
 printf("\n");
 }
 for (i = 1; i <= 19; i++)
 {
 for (n = 1; n <= 19; n++)
 {
 gotoxy_red(i, n);
 printf(" ");
 }
 }
}


//随机产生敌机
void dfeiji()
{
 while (t)
 {
 if (!r) { d = rand() % 17 + 1; m++; } //r,r1,r2 初始值都为1,当变为0的时候开始产生随机数
 if (!r1) { d1 = rand() % 17 + 1; m++; }
 if (!r2) { d2 = rand() % 17 + 1; m++; }

 while (t)
 { 
 r=r+2; r1=r1+2; r2=r2+2;
 gotoxy(d, r); printf("b");//d,d1, d2 为敌机产生的位置,都为10
 gotoxy(d1, r1); printf("c");
 gotoxy(d2, r2); printf("d");
 Sleep(900);
 gotoxy(d, r); printf(" ");
 gotoxy(d1, r1); printf(" ");
 gotoxy(d2, r2); printf(" ");


 kongzhi(0, 0);//控制飞机后,要立即进行判断
 byebye();//判断飞机有没有死亡
 if (r == 19) r = 0;
 if (r1 == 19) r1 = 0;
 if (r2 == 19) r2 = 0;
 if (r == 0 || r1 == 0 || r2 == 0) break;
 }
 }
}


//操控飞机
void kongzhi(int bx, int by)//调用的时候传入了 0, 0
{
 int a;


 while (_kbhit())
 {
 if ((p = _getch()) == -32) p = _getch();
 a = p;
 gotoxy(22, 5);

 switch (a)
 {//控制方向
 case Up:if (y != 1)
 {
 gotoxy(x, y); printf(" ");
 y--;
 gotoxy(x, y); printf("A");
 }break;
 case Down:if (y != 18)
 {
 gotoxy(x, y); printf(" ");
 y++;
 gotoxy(x, y); printf("A");
 }break;
 case Left:if (x != 1)
 {
 gotoxy(x, y); printf(" ");
 x--;
 gotoxy(x, y); printf("A");
 }break;
 case Right:if (x != 18)
 {
 gotoxy(x, y); printf(" ");
 x++;
 gotoxy(x, y); printf("A");
 }break;
 case Kong: { bx = y;//先把y的值存起来,存到bx
 for (by = y; by > 1;) //发射子弹, y轴坐标一直减减,打印 |
 {
 by--;//y的坐标
 gotoxy(x, by); printf("|");
 Sleep(10);
 gotoxy(x, by); printf(" ");
 y = by;//记录子弹打到哪了,好进行碰撞检测
 jifan();//计分数
 if (r == 0 || r1 == 0 || r2 == 0) break;
 }
 y = bx;//恢复y的值
 }break;

 case Esc:t = 0; break; //退出

 default:break;
 }
 }
}

int main()
{
 srand(time(NULL));
 shuoming();//打印游戏说明,之后让光标进入0,0
 hidden();//隐藏光标,不让光标显示
 huatu();//画出墙壁
 gotoxy(x, y);//x=10,y=8, x 和y 是自己飞机的坐标,是全局变量
 printf("A");

 gotoxy(50, 2);
 printf("Score:");
 while (t) //t是一个全局变量 初始值为1
 {
 kongzhi(0, 0);//调用控制飞机函数, (操作飞机后并记分数)
 if (t) //如果游戏没有结束,则 产生敌机
 dfeiji();//产生敌机 ,并判断飞机有没有死亡
 }

}

2.(封装了一个函数)结束游戏后能够重新开始进行下一局

/*隐藏光标的代码
#include <stdio.h>
#include <windows.h>
int main()
{
HANDLE handle = GetStdHandle(STD_OUTPUT_HANDLE);
CONSOLE_CURSOR_INFO CursorInfo;
GetConsoleCursorInfo(handle, &CursorInfo);//获取控制台光标信息
CursorInfo.bVisible = false; //隐藏控制台光标
SetConsoleCursorInfo(handle, &CursorInfo);//设置控制台光标状态
 
 
getchar();
}*/
/* 
 明白两个事实,
 敌人飞机和自己的飞机的横坐标和纵坐标相同时 表示死亡
 敌人飞机和自己的子弹碰撞即 子弹坐标和自己子弹的坐标相同时,飞机死亡并且加分,
*/

#include "stdio.h"
#include <windows.h>
#include <conio.h>
#include <time.h>
#define Esc 27 //退出
#define Up 72 //上,下,左,右
#define Down 80
#define Left 75
#define Right 77
#define Kong 32 //发射子弹


int x = 10; //飞机坐标
int y = 18;

int d2 = 10;//敌机坐标
int d1 = 10;
int d = 10;//d 和r 用来进行碰撞检测
int r = 1;
int r1 = 1;
int r2 = 1;


int t = 1; // 游戏结束
int f = 0; // 计分数
int m = 5; // 敌机数
int j = 0; // 歼敌数
char p; // 接受按键


void kongzhi(int bx, int by);//声明函数
void huatu();


void gotoxy(int x, int y) //移动坐标
{
 COORD coord;
 coord.X = x;
 coord.Y = y;
 SetConsoleCursorPosition(GetStdHandle(STD_OUTPUT_HANDLE), coord);
 SetConsoleTextAttribute(GetStdHandle(STD_OUTPUT_HANDLE),3);
 
}
void gotoxy_red(int x, int y) //移动坐标
{
 COORD coord;
 coord.X = x;
 coord.Y = y;
 SetConsoleCursorPosition(GetStdHandle(STD_OUTPUT_HANDLE), coord);
 SetConsoleTextAttribute(GetStdHandle(STD_OUTPUT_HANDLE),4);
 
}
void gotoxy_blue(int x, int y) //移动坐标
{
 COORD coord;
 coord.X = x;
 coord.Y = y;
 SetConsoleCursorPosition(GetStdHandle(STD_OUTPUT_HANDLE), coord);
 SetConsoleTextAttribute(GetStdHandle(STD_OUTPUT_HANDLE),1);
 
}
void gotoxy_green(int x, int y) //移动坐标
{
 COORD coord;
 coord.X = x;
 coord.Y = y;
 SetConsoleCursorPosition(GetStdHandle(STD_OUTPUT_HANDLE), coord);
 SetConsoleTextAttribute(GetStdHandle(STD_OUTPUT_HANDLE),2);
 
}
void hidden()//隐藏光标,不让光标显示
{
 HANDLE hOut = GetStdHandle(STD_OUTPUT_HANDLE);
 CONSOLE_CURSOR_INFO cci;
 GetConsoleCursorInfo(hOut, &cci);
 cci.bVisible = 0;//赋1为显示,赋0为隐藏
 SetConsoleCursorInfo(hOut, &cci);
}
//**************************************************************************************


//说明
void shuoming()
{
 printf("\t\t\t\n\n\n\n");
 gotoxy_blue(0, 0);
 printf("\t\t\t\t\t\t\tPlane Control\n\n"
 "\t\t\t\t\t\t\t\tUP\n\n"
 "\t\t\t\t\t\t\tDown\n\n"
 "\t\t\t\t\t\t\tLeft \n\n"
 "\t\t\t\t\t\t\tRight \n\n"
 "\t\t\t\t\t\t\t bullet space\n\n\n"
 "\t\t\t\t\t\t\tQuit Esc\n");
 

 gotoxy_red(0, 0);
}


//****************************************************************************************


//判断我机死没死/游戏结束
void byebye()
{
 if (((x == d && y == r) || (x == d1 && y == r1) || (x == d2 && y == r2))||( (d>=19||r>=19)||(d1>=19||r1>=19)||(d1>=19||r1>=19) ))
 {
 gotoxy(1, 3);
 printf(" !!! game over !!!\n"
 "*******************\n"
 " score: %d\n\n"
 " di ji shu: %d\n"
 " jian di shu: %d\n"
 " ming zhong lv: %.0f %%\n"
 "*******************\n", f, m, j, ((float)j / (float)m) * 100);
 t=0;
 
 }
}
// 计分/更新敌机
void jifan()
{ //x,y是子弹的坐标
 if (x == d && y == r) // d=10, r=1, d,d1,d2 是敌机的x轴, 为10 ,r为敌机的纵坐标
 {
 gotoxy(d, r); printf("3");
 Sleep(200);
 gotoxy(d, r); printf(" "); f += 2; r = 0; j++;//让r=0,即是让敌人的飞机消失
 }
 if (x == d1 && y == r1)
 {
 gotoxy(d1, r1); printf("1");
 Sleep(200);
 gotoxy(d1, r1); printf(" "); f += 3; r1 = 0; j++;
 }
 if (x == d2 && y == r2)
 {
 gotoxy(d2, r2); printf("0");
 Sleep(200);
 gotoxy(d2, r2); printf(" "); f += 1; r2 = 0; j++;
 }

 gotoxy(57, 2);
 printf("%d\n", f);

}
//画图
void huatu()
{
 int i, n;

 for (i = 0; i <= 20; i++)
 {
 for (n = 0; n <= 20; n++)
 {
 printf("*");
 }
 printf("\n");
 }
 for (i = 1; i <= 19; i++)
 {
 for (n = 1; n <= 19; n++)
 {
 gotoxy_red(i, n);
 printf(" ");
 }
 }
}


//随机产生敌机
void dfeiji()
{
 while (t)
 {
 if (!r) { d = rand() % 17 + 1; m++; } //r,r1,r2 初始值都为1,当变为0的时候开始产生随机数
 if (!r1) { d1 = rand() % 17 + 1; m++; }
 if (!r2) { d2 = rand() % 17 + 1; m++; }

 while (t)
 { 
 r=r+2; r1=r1+2; r2=r2+2;
 gotoxy(d, r); printf("b");//d,d1, d2 为敌机产生的位置,都为10
 gotoxy(d1, r1); printf("c");
 gotoxy(d2, r2); printf("d");
 Sleep(900);
 gotoxy(d, r); printf(" ");
 gotoxy(d1, r1); printf(" ");
 gotoxy(d2, r2); printf(" ");


 kongzhi(0, 0);//控制飞机后,要立即进行判断
 byebye();//判断飞机有没有死亡
 if (r == 19) r = 0;
 if (r1 == 19) r1 = 0;
 if (r2 == 19) r2 = 0;
 if (r == 0 || r1 == 0 || r2 == 0) break;
 }
 }
}


//操控飞机
void kongzhi(int bx, int by)//调用的时候传入了 0, 0
{
 int a;


 while (_kbhit())
 {
 if ((p = _getch()) == -32) p = _getch();
 a = p;
 gotoxy(22, 5);

 switch (a)
 {//控制方向
 case Up:if (y != 1)
 {
 gotoxy(x, y); printf(" ");
 y--;
 gotoxy(x, y); printf("A");
 }break;
 case Down:if (y != 18)
 {
 gotoxy(x, y); printf(" ");
 y++;
 gotoxy(x, y); printf("A");
 }break;
 case Left:if (x != 1)
 {
 gotoxy(x, y); printf(" ");
 x--;
 gotoxy(x, y); printf("A");
 }break;
 case Right:if (x != 18)
 {
 gotoxy(x, y); printf(" ");
 x++;
 gotoxy(x, y); printf("A");
 }break;
 case Kong: { bx = y;//先把y的值存起来,存到bx
 for (by = y; by > 1;) //发射子弹, y轴坐标一直减减,打印 |
 {
 by--;//y的坐标
 gotoxy(x, by); printf("|");
 Sleep(10);
 gotoxy(x, by); printf(" ");
 y = by;//记录子弹打到哪了,好进行碰撞检测
 jifan();//计分数
 if (r == 0 || r1 == 0 || r2 == 0) break;
 }
 y = bx;//恢复y的值
 }break;

 case Esc:t = 0; break; //退出

 default:break;
 }
 }
}

void zuzhong(){
 x = 10; //飞机坐标
  y = 18;

 d2 = 10;//敌机坐标
 d1 = 10;
 d = 10;//d 和r 用来进行碰撞检测
 r = 1;
 r1 = 1;
 r2 = 1;


 t = 1; // 游戏结束
 f = 0; // 计分数
 m = 5; // 敌机数
 j = 0; // 歼敌数
char p; // 接受按键

 srand(time(NULL));
 shuoming();//打印游戏说明,之后让光标进入0,0
 hidden();//隐藏光标,不让光标显示
 huatu();//画出墙壁
 gotoxy(x, y);//x=10,y=8, x 和y 是自己飞机的坐标,是全局变量
 printf("A");

 gotoxy(50, 2);
 printf("Score:");
 while (t) //t是一个全局变量 初始值为1
 {
 kongzhi(0, 0);//调用控制飞机函数, (操作飞机后并记分数)
 if (t) //如果游戏没有结束,则 产生敌机
 dfeiji();//产生敌机 ,并判断飞机有没有死亡
 }

}
int main()
{
 while(1){
 system("cls");
 zuzhong();
 printf("please enter Enter key contine");
 getchar();
 } 
}
